The likely mechanism by which an asteroid killed the dinosaurs, 65 million years ago, was that the very large impact threw a large amount of dust and particulate matter into the atmosphere, which then blocked out the sunlight long enough to disrupt the existing food chain.

Did a supernova kill the dinosaurs?

Probably not. Current evidence suggests that the dinosaurs were wiped out by an asteroid impact, possibly in combination with an outburst of volcanic activity.
